What does a part time tax accountant do?

A Part Time Tax Accountant is responsible for preparing, reviewing, and filing tax returns for individuals or businesses on a part-time basis. They analyze financial records, ensure compliance with tax laws, and help clients minimize their tax liability. Additionally, they may assist with tax planning, respond to tax authority inquiries, and keep up-to-date with changes in tax regulations. Their role can vary depending on the size of the firm and the complexity of the clients' needs.

What does a tax accountant who works part time do?

As a tax accountant, your responsibilities center around the preparation of tax returns. You work for multiple clients as a freelancer or on behalf of a firm. For each client, you prepare their financial record, make a statement to inform them of any changes in tax law, and file their return for them. Your duties also include helping clients save on their returns where they can and minimizing tax liability while ensuring compliance with state and federal law. Working part-time, you take on clients as an independent contractor during tax season or work with clients on an as-needed basis.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a part time tax accountant?

To thrive as a Part Time Tax Accountant, you need strong accounting knowledge, tax preparation expertise, and a relevant degree or CPA certification. Familiarity with tax software (like QuickBooks, TurboTax, or Drake), Microsoft Excel, and electronic filing systems is essential. Attention to detail, time management, and strong client communication skills set top performers apart in this role. These skills ensure accurate tax filings, compliance with regulations, and effective client service in a deadline-driven environment.

How does a part time tax accountant typically manage workload during peak tax season?

Part-time tax accountants often experience increased workloads during tax season, which may require adjusting their schedules to accommodate client needs and tight deadlines. Employers usually offer flexible hours or additional shifts during this period, but clear communication about availability is essential. Many part-time accountants collaborate closely with full-time staff and other team members to divide tasks, complete filings, and ensure compliance. Being organized and proactive in managing multiple client accounts is crucial for meeting deadlines and maintaining work-life balance.

What is the difference between Part Time Tax Accountant vs Part Time Bookkeeper?

AspectPart Time Tax AccountantPart Time Bookkeeper
Required CredentialsCPA or Enrolled Agent often preferredNo specific certifications typically required
Work EnvironmentAccounting firms, corporate finance departments, or freelanceSmall businesses, accounting firms, or freelance
Employer & Industry UsageUsed in tax preparation, planning, and complianceUsed for daily financial record-keeping

The main difference is that a Part Time Tax Accountant focuses on tax-related tasks, requiring certifications like CPA, while a Part Time Bookkeeper handles daily financial records without necessarily needing certifications. Both roles are common in accounting and finance sectors, but they serve different functions within a business's financial management.

Are tax accountants still in demand?

Tax accountants remain in demand due to ongoing needs for tax preparation, planning, and compliance services. The role often requires knowledge of current tax laws and proficiency with accounting software, and demand tends to be steady regardless of economic fluctuations.
